name: PR GitHub hygiene

# Lint the GitHub process, not the code. Fail unless:
# 1) PR body line 1 is Fixes/Closes/Resolves #N (or org/repo#N)
# 2) Development sidebar has a linked Issue
# or the PR is labeled skip-issue-link.
# Self-contained — copy this file only; do not import repo scripts.
# Require the check `pr-github-hygiene` on the default branch AFTER this
# file exists there (required-before-land freezes unrelated open PRs).

on:
pull_request:
types: [opened, edited, synchronize, reopened, labeled, unlabeled]

permissions:
contents: read
pull-requests: read
issues: read

jobs:
hygiene:
name: pr-github-hygiene
runs-on: ubuntu-22.04
steps:
- name: Check driving Issue link
env:
GH_TOKEN: ${{ github.token }}
PR_NUMBER: ${{ github.event.pull_request.number }}
REPO: ${{ github.repository }}
run: |
set -euo pipefail
python3 - <<'PY'
import json, os, re, subprocess, sys

SKIP = "skip-issue-link"
FIRST = re.compile(
r"^(?:fixes|closes|resolves)\s+(?:"
r"(?P<owner>[\w.-]+)/(?P<repo>[\w.-]+)#(?P<cross>\d+)"
r"|#(?P<same>\d+)"
r")\s*$",
re.I,
)

def first_line(body: str) -> str:
for line in (body or "").splitlines():
s = line.strip()
if s:
return s
return ""

repo = os.environ["REPO"]
pr = os.environ["PR_NUMBER"]
owner, name = repo.split("/", 1)
query = """
query($owner: String!, $name: String!, $number: Int!) {
repository(owner: $owner, name: $name) {
pullRequest(number: $number) {
body
labels(first: 30) { nodes { name } }
closingIssuesReferences(first: 10) {
nodes { number }
}
}
}
}
"""
payload = {
"query": query,
"variables": {"owner": owner, "name": name, "number": int(pr)},
}
proc = subprocess.run(
["gh", "api", "graphql", "--input", "-"],
input=json.dumps(payload),
text=True,
capture_output=True,
check=False,
)
if proc.returncode != 0:
print(proc.stderr or proc.stdout, file=sys.stderr)
raise SystemExit(1)
data = json.loads(proc.stdout)
if data.get("errors"):
print(json.dumps(data["errors"]), file=sys.stderr)
raise SystemExit(1)
pr_obj = data["data"]["repository"]["pullRequest"]
labels = {
(n.get("name") or "").strip().lower()
for n in ((pr_obj.get("labels") or {}).get("nodes") or [])
}
if SKIP in labels:
print(json.dumps({"ok": True, "skipped": True, "pr": int(pr)}))
raise SystemExit(0)
reasons = []
if not FIRST.match(first_line(pr_obj.get("body") or "")):
reasons.append(
"PR body line 1 must be Fixes/Closes/Resolves #N "
"(or Fixes org/repo#N)"
)
nums = [
n.get("number")
for n in ((pr_obj.get("closingIssuesReferences") or {}).get("nodes") or [])
if isinstance(n.get("number"), int)
]
if not nums:
reasons.append(
"GitHub Development sidebar has no linked Issue. "
f"Add Fixes #N on line 1 or label the PR `{SKIP}`."
)
print(json.dumps({"ok": not reasons, "reasons": reasons, "issues": nums, "pr": int(pr)}))
if reasons:
for r in reasons:
print(f"::error::{r}", file=sys.stderr)
raise SystemExit(1)
PY
